Yeah you don't have odds for set value here. Hmmm. GT1T have you seen him 4bet like this before?
I'm just not inclined to mess around with a 4-bettor who's OOP. I certainly don't think it's worth putting the rest of your stack in right now. Rough estimations on that are that it's probably -EV. Also, if he's cbetting the flop every single time I'd rather just fold it now and save myself $100. I could see JJ/QQ just wanting to win the pot right here against your 4bet. I could also see AA/KK hoping that you'll stick the rest in there. Just isn't worth losing your stack w/ TT here and calling is a pretty bad option as well. So, you haven't invested much, pot's small, you're likely behind, pushing now is bad... I like a muck. |
